Thai Airways to increase ticket prices by up to 15% on rising fuel costs
Thai Airways is implementing a 10% to 15% fare increase to offset rising fuel costs and supply chain issues. The airline noted that these increases are fuel surcharges and remain within the current price ceiling. Positive advance bookings in March and passenger diversions from Middle Eastern airspace are also contributing to the airline's outlook.

Choked shipping routes jolt Indian manufacturers
India's manufacturing sector faces disruption due to the Iran war. Critical shipping routes are threatened, impacting automakers and component makers. Consumer goods and electronics exporters are already halting shipments and production. Industry bodies seek government support for fuel supplies. Companies are assessing supply chain risks, with some setting up crisis teams.

TVS Supply Chain sets up warehouse in Chennai to support Caterpillar India
TVS Supply Chain Solutions has set up a 40,000 sq. ft. warehouse in Mannur village to strengthen Caterpillar India Pvt Ltd's global supply chain operations. Shares of TVS Supply Chain Solutions ended marginally lower on Tuesday, March 10, by 0.65% at 106.00 on the NSE.
